Filipino Community of Guam celebrates 70 years with Pista Sa Nayon

Mabuhay! Congratulations are in order for the Filipino Community of Guam as they embark on a 70-year milestone. The community is celebrating with a bang this weekend, and you’re invited.
They’re a vibrant people woven into the colorful fabric that makes up the island - from their unique culture and arts, to their countless contributions, and their knack for a good time/
Patrick Luces, president of the FCOG, told KUAM News, “We say it's fun in the Philippines, but this weekend, it’s gonna be fun down at the Pista Sa Nayon down at Ypao beach.”
It’s a fiesta at Ypao Beach Park, better known as Pista Sa Nayon, as the Filipino Community of Guam celebrates 70 years.
FCOG member Andy Padilla added, “Come over, we invite you all!”
It’s an invitation you won’t want to pass up, as the event promises an endless line up of fun. Luces continued, “We’ll have a lot of food trucks, food vendors, local crafters/jewelers will be there, a petting station, so bring out the kids; we’ll have carnival rides.”
And entertainment you don't want to miss -with headlining acts Inigo Pascual and Sheryn Regis set to take the stage alongside other notable performers.
Join the celebration this Saturday, July 13th at Ypao Beach Park in Tumon from 2pm-9pm.
Parking is available at John F. Kennedy High School with a shuttle service from available to the park every 15 minutes.
